What is the best time to undertake the Vaishno Devi yatra for first-time pilgrims? +
For first-time pilgrims, the best time to visit Vaishno Devi is during the months of March to October. This period typically offers pleasant weather and a more comfortable journey to the holy shrine. During peak seasons like Navratri, the yatra can be more crowded, so planning your visit accordingly can enhance your experience.
What should first-time pilgrims know about the transportation options to Vaishno Devi? +
First-time pilgrims can choose from various transportation options to reach Vaishno Devi. The nearest major city is Jammu, which is well-connected by air, train, and road. From Jammu, you can take a taxi or bus to Katra, the base camp for the yatra. Additionally, there are pony and palanquin services available for those who prefer not to walk the 13-kilometer trek to the shrine.
Are there any accommodations available for first-time pilgrims near the Vaishno Devi shrine? +
Yes, there are various accommodation options available for first-time pilgrims near the Vaishno Devi shrine. Katra offers a range of hotels, guesthouses, and dharamshalas to suit different budgets. Many of these accommodations provide easy access to the yatra starting point and can be booked in advance for a hassle-free experience.
What essential items should first-time pilgrims carry on their Vaishno Devi yatra? +
First-time pilgrims should carry essential items such as comfortable walking shoes, water bottles, a light backpack, rain gear, and some basic medications. It is also advisable to wear modest clothes, carry a valid ID, and have cash for local purchases along the route. Being prepared will make your yatra more enjoyable and convenient.
How can first-time pilgrims ensure a safe and smooth experience during the Vaishno Devi yatra? +
First-time pilgrims can ensure a safe and smooth experience during the Vaishno Devi yatra by planning their trip well in advance, maintaining physical fitness for the trek, adhering to the weather forecast, and keeping their belongings secure. Additionally, staying hydrated and taking breaks during the journey will help manage fatigue and enhance the overall spiritual experience.

Best Time to Visit

The best time to visit Vaishno Devi is from March to October, when the weather is pleasant and suitable for the yatra. March-June is ideal for comfortable trekking, while September-October offers fewer crowds after the monsoon. Winters (November-February) are very cold with possible snowfall but are preferred by devotees seeking a peaceful darshan. Navratri periods attract heavy crowds and require advance planning.

Nearest Airport / Railway Station

  • Jammu Airport (Satwari Airport - IXJ) 50 km
  • Shri Mata Vaishno Devi Katra Railway Station (SVDK) 2-3 kms
